It's more a teaching experience where you learn how to do the transports, navigate to hospital, do the paperwork. As an IFT EMT this process is not really a test. maybe 1 day of skills/sims and 1 day of EVOC (Ambulance Driving Test), but on the upside you do get paid during it! After that you are assigned an FTO where you will be the third member on a unit for about 10 shifts. Orientation is looooooong week, mostly powerpoints on what not to do and how to get fired. When I first started you would go through your PAT and drug test, the VSTs would take your uniform measurements that day and order them, you might not have them by orientation. Hey, I'll preface that I was in your exact position a couple years ago and I'm now a paramedic that can hopefully shed some insight. PS be nice to the VSTs and we'll give you the transits ) You also should get a stipend for purchasing boots. You'll get to know your hospitals really well, and get some patient care experience if you plan to move to 911 which they call EMT Bridge. Otherwise, IFT units will run anywhere from 2-8 calls a shift, with the occasional level 4 911 so don't get complacent on your skills. You have a chance to get on a CCT unit as well, in which case you'll be mostly driving and helping the nurse.

You'll be checking in/out equipment with the VSTs.(radio, med box, aed). Your uniforms will take about a month or so to get here so when you get your loaners take good care of them. At some point you'll also do EVOC(hopefully within your first month or so) and then you'll be able to drive! I'm pretty sure IFT units are posted when not on calls, often waiting in hospitals and what not. Then you'll begin field training under an FTO, which you'll have to clear within a week or two(Brush up assessments, vitals, and documentation/getting a history).
